The Madhya Pradesh government has entered into memoranda of understanding (MoUs) with 18 companies in the private sector for setting up power plants with a total installed capacity of around 7,600 mw, said state energy minister N P Prajapati yesterday. In a written reply to a question, the minister said these plants were expected to be commissioned in periods varying from 1998-99 to 2003-2004. Answering another question, Prajapati said the government was also planning to set up mini power plants with a capacity of 25 mw each at 36 places.
